Output 351eaf71c483df35e24c2b7c89fa75bc5ec5f0a67421e9a78b090410ef44a932:1

value
2669110
script pubkey
OP_0 OP_PUSHBYTES_20 bd2b3fb739a0373a9c22e014436dbd516fa9a82c
address
ltc1qh54nldee5qmn48pzuq2yxmda29h6n2pva06wt4
transaction
351eaf71c483df35e24c2b7c89fa75bc5ec5f0a67421e9a78b090410ef44a932
spent
true